首页 > 代码库 > springmvc小结

springmvc小结

spring配置:

  • <context:component-scan>

在xml配置了这个标签后,spring可以自动去扫描base-pack下面或者子包下面的java文件,如果扫描到有@Component, @Repository, @Service, @Controller这些注解的类,则把这些类注册为bean。

 参考:http://blog.csdn.net/chunqiuwei/article/details/16115135,http://www.cnblogs.com/xdp-gacl/p/3495887.html,并参考官方文档。

  • @Autowired

@Autowired可以对成员变量、方法和构造函数进行标注,来完成自动装配的工作,这里必须明确:@Autowired是根据类型进行自动装配的,如果需要按名称进行装配,则需要配合@Qualifier使用。

参考:http://blog.csdn.net/heyutao007/article/details/5981555,并参考官方文档。

springmvc配置:

 1 <!-- spring mvc servlet --> 2 <servlet> 3     <description>spring mvc servlet</description> 4     <servlet-name>springMvc</servlet-name> 5     <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class> 6     <init-param> 7         <description>spring mvc 配置文件</description> 8         <param-name>contextConfigLocation</param-name> 9         <param-value>classpath:spring-mvc.xml</param-value>10     </init-param>11     <load-on-startup>1</load-on-startup>12 </servlet>13 <servlet-mapping>14     <servlet-name>springMvc</servlet-name>15     <url-pattern>*.do</url-pattern>16 </servlet-mapping>

 

springmvc小结